Code C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4 Description
The C1424 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for a 2016 Toyota RAV4 specifically indicates a malfunction in the output of the master cylinder pressure sensor. The master cylinder pressure sensor is a crucial component of the vehicle's brake system, responsible for monitoring the pressure within the master cylinder. This sensor plays a vital role in ensuring the proper functioning of the vehicle's brake system by providing feedback to the vehicle's electronic control unit (ECU) about the pressure applied to the brakes.
Common Causes of C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4
- Faulty master cylinder pressure sensor.
- Wiring or connector issues affecting sensor communication.
- Sensor calibration errors.
- Damage to the sensor due to external factors.
- Electronic control unit (ECU) malfunction affecting sensor readings.
Symptoms of C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4
- Illumination of the brake warning light on the dashboard.
- Inconsistent brake pedal feel or response.
- Longer stopping distances than usual.
- ABS system activation without reason.
- Loss of brake assist functionality.
How to Fix C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4
- Begin by conducting a comprehensive diagnostic scan to confirm the C1424 code and identify the specific cause of the master cylinder pressure sensor malfunction.
- Inspect the sensor, wiring, and connectors for any visible damage or corrosion. Replace any damaged components as needed.
- Calibrate the master cylinder pressure sensor according to manufacturer specifications to ensure accurate readings.
- Clear the DTC from the vehicle's ECU memory and perform a road test to verify that the issue has been resolved.
- If the problem persists, consult with a professional mechanic or dealership for further troubleshooting and repair options.
Cost to Fix C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4
The typical repair costs for addressing a master cylinder pressure sensor output malfunction can vary depending on the extent of the issue and the specific components that require replacement. In general, the cost of parts for a new master cylinder pressure sensor can range from $100 to $300, while labor costs for diagnosis and repair can range from $150 to $400. Overall, the total repair cost for this issue may fall within the range of $250 to $700, excluding any additional fees or taxes.

Frequently Asked Questions about C1424 2016 Toyota RAV4 Code
1. What does the OBDII code C1424 mean on a 2016 Toyota RAV4?
C1424 indicates a "Master Cylinder Pressure Sensor Output Malfunction," meaning the vehicle's brake pressure sensor is detecting abnormal or inconsistent signals.
2. What are the common symptoms of code C1424 in a 2016 Toyota RAV4?
Symptoms may include the ABS or traction control warning lights turning on, reduced braking performance, or erratic braking behavior.
3. What causes the C1424 code to appear in a 2016 Toyota RAV4?
The code can be triggered by a faulty master cylinder pressure sensor, damaged wiring or connectors, or issues with the ABS module.
4. Is it safe to drive with the C1424 code active?
It may not be safe, as the braking system could be compromised. Reduced braking performance or inconsistent braking could increase the risk of an accident.
5. How do you diagnose the C1424 code on a 2016 Toyota RAV4?
A technician will use a scan tool to confirm the code, inspect the master cylinder pressure sensor and its wiring, and test the ABS system for proper operation.
6. Can a faulty master cylinder pressure sensor be repaired, or does it need replacement?
In most cases, the master cylinder pressure sensor will need to be replaced if it is found to be faulty.
7. How much does it cost to fix the C1424 code on a 2016 Toyota RAV4?
The repair cost depends on the exact issue but typically ranges from $150 to $500, including parts and labor.
8. Can I reset the C1424 code without fixing the issue?
You can clear the code with an OBDII scanner, but if the underlying issue isn’t addressed, the code will likely reappear.
9. Does the C1424 code affect other systems in the 2016 Toyota RAV4?
Yes, it can impact the ABS and traction control systems, potentially leading to reduced vehicle stability during braking.
10. How can I prevent the C1424 code from occurring?
Regular maintenance, inspecting brake components, and addressing warning lights promptly can help prevent issues leading to the C1424 code.
